Bruschetta with White Beans, Tomatoes and Olives

Servings: 20
Makes a great appetizer for parties!
Ingredients:
1 cup dried great northern beans
3 plum tomatoes, seeded,chopped
1/4 cup chopped pitted kalamata olive
6 tablespoons olive oil
1/4 cup chopped fresh basil
1 tablespoon minced garlic
1 french baguette, cut into 1-inch thick rounds
5 -6 ounces soft fresh goat cheese, room temperature (such as montrachet)
Directions:
1. Place beans in large saucepan.
2. Add enough cold water to cover by 3 inches.
3. Bring to boil.
4. Cover and remove from heat.
5. Let stand 1 hour.
6. Drain beans; return to pan.
7. Add enough cold water to cover by 3 inches.
8. Bring to boil.
9. Reduce heat and simmer until tender, stirring occasionally, about 1 hour 10 minutes.
10. Drain and cool.
11. Transfer 1 1/2 cups beans to medium bowl (reserve remaining beans for another use).
12. Mix in tomatoes, olives, 4 tablespoons oil, basil and garlic.
13. Season to taste with salt and pepper.
14. Preheat broiler.
15. Place bread on baking sheet.
16. Brush with 2 tablespoons oil.
17. Broil until golden, about 1 minute.
18. Spread with cheese.
19. Top with bean mixture.
